En este artículo te vamos a hablar sobre algunos comandos básicos que te ayudarán a la hora de gestionar la cola de correo de Postfix, así podrás revisar cuántos correos hay en cola, eliminarlos, …
El primer paso que tienes que dar es acceder mediante SSH a tu servidor para poder ejecutar los siguientes comandos:
Información Adicional
Puedes encontrar más información sobre el acceso por SSH a tu servidor en el artículo:
- Este primer comando, te mostrará todos los mensajes de la cola de correo, pero sin información detallada:
mailq
- Si has utilizado el comando mailq, y copias el ID de un correo, podrás visualizar su contenido con el siguiente comando:
postcat -q ID
- El siguiente comando, sirve para elimina por completo toda la cola de correo que tengas en el momento de lanzarlo:
postsuper -d ALL
- Para elimina todos los mensajes que hayan sido devueltos por los destinatarios, por la razón que sea, puedes utilizar el comando:
postsuper -d ALL deferred
- Por último, el siguiente comando te mostrará, con un número, cuantos mensajes hay actualmente en la cola:
postqueue -p | tail -n 1 | cut -d' ' -f5